  • Abstract
    This letter presents a cooperative spectrum sensing scheme with beamforming for cognitive radio networks. Here, secondary users report spectrum measurements to a fusion center simultaneously with assigned beamforming weights. Under correlated log-normal shadowing, optimal beamforming weights are derived to maximize the global detection probability subject to a global transmit power constraint. Global detection performance with optimal beamforming weights is then evaluated. The analysis is tested on a linear, equi-distant network where secondary users have identical channel gains to the fusion center. Results show that more secondary users improve detection performance.
